Protect against Blockages


One of the most noticeable factors for cleaning your restroom drains pipes on a monthly basis is to avoid clogs. A whole lot much more decreases the drainpipe than you would certainly think-- skin flakes, eyelashes, dust, and hair. Every one of these fragments collect as well as eventually cause obstructions. Also a small blockage can make your sink or shower basically unusable. When you clean your drains pipes consistently, you will not wind up with deep blockages that call for strong chemicals and also expert tools. While you can clean your restroom drains pipes on your own, we suggest that you call a plumber to properly clean your drains pipes a couple of times per year.

Determine Underlying Issues


When you clean your drainpipe once a month, you can determine underlying concerns before they end up being significant problems. For example, if you notice particles appearing of your shower room drains with a serpent cleaner, they could be rusting. Any irregular products coming out of a drainpipe must raise problems. If it is not just the regular hair as well as gunk, you must call a plumber to see if your bathroom drains pipes demand to be repaired.

Reason for Having Clogged Drain




One of the main reasons drains become clogged is all the hair that goes down them. You can install a drain catch in your shower or bathtub to prevent this from happening. This will capture the hair before it can go down the drain and cause a blockage. You should also regularly clean the drain catch – otherwise, it will fill up with hair over time.



Another common cause of clogged drains is soap scum. Soap scum is a build-up of soap residue, body oils, and dirt that gets stuck to the sides of your drain. If left unchecked, soap scum can eventually lead to a complete blockage. To prevent this, you should regularly clean your drain with a mild cleanser. You can also use a plunger to remove any build-up that has already occurred.



If your drains are still giving you trouble, there are a few other things you can try. One option is to pour boiling water down the drain – this will help to break up any clogs that may be present. Another option is to use a plumbers’ snake – a long, flexible tool that can reach deep into the drain and clear any obstructions. If all else fails, you may need to call in a professional plumber to take care of the problem for you.
